Output dd99966a4f385069b9efecd62bb7a909ef18ee00c853ee8cb7ed633be4b72ec5:1

value
10224179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 282a8eafbd5fdcd5dd24a348b3109d8e20550d48 OP_EQUAL
address
35MPw9w3SzMEYVkCpDV3AqiwipMniq1q3K
transaction
dd99966a4f385069b9efecd62bb7a909ef18ee00c853ee8cb7ed633be4b72ec5
spent
true